Bejegyzések

Bejegyzések megjelenítése ebből a hónapból: február, 2009

SMTP client for .Net Framework and .Net Compact Framework

Érdekes feladat előtt álltam. Egy .Net CF alkalmazásból kellett volna e-mailt küldeni SMTP szerveren keresztül. A .Net CF-ből viszont hiányik az smtpclient osztály. Van viszont net.sockets osztály. A feladat így megvalósítható, de nem olyan egyszerű. Ekkor jön a gugli, a keresgélés. Találtam is több forrást, de a legtöbből hiányzik a csatolt fájlok lehetősége. Szerencsére ez másnak is probléma ezért pár óra alatt találtam olyan forrást, amiben ez is benne van már (codeproject oldalon). Ezen is kellett kicsit módosítani, mert compact framework-ön nem működött. A módosított forrás viszont már igen. A használata rém egyszerű. Pl: try {     SmtpEmailer smtp = new SmtpEmailer();     SmtpAttachment attachment = new SmtpAttachment(@...